Casino Free No Download: The Grim Reality Behind the Hype

First off, the term “casino free no download” sounds like a marketing miracle, but the math says otherwise: a 0.5% house edge on a $10,000 bankroll translates to a $50 expected loss per hour, even before any “free” spins are tossed your way.

Why “Free” Is Just a Loaded Word

Take the 2023 promotion from Bet365 that offered 30 “free” spins on a single‑line slot. The average payout on that slot sits at 96.2%, meaning the expected return per spin is $9.62 on a $10 bet—still a $0.38 loss each spin, multiplied by 30 equals $11.40 wasted on a gimmick.

And then there’s the “VIP” gift badge you see on 888casino’s landing page. It promises a “complimentary” bankroll boost, yet the fine print caps it at 0.1% of your deposit, which for a $200 deposit is a pitiful $0.20—hardly charitable.

Because the “free” component never translates to free money, it’s merely a lure to increase your deposit volume. In my experience, a $50 deposit triggered a 100% “match” bonus, but the wagering requirement of 35× forced a $1,750 playthrough before any cash could be extracted.

Downloading Nothing, Yet Still Paying

Imagine a browser‑based casino that advertises “no download required” while still demanding a 3% transaction fee on every deposit. For a $100 top‑up, that’s $3 gone before you even see a single chip, plus the inevitable latency of a server located 12,000 km away from Toronto.

But the real kicker is the hidden cost of “instant play.” The interface of the platform often lags 2.3 seconds per spin on a 4G connection, effectively turning a rapid‑fire slot like Gonzo’s Quest into a snail‑pace grind that burns through your bankroll quicker than you can say “I’m lucky.”

Or consider the “no download” version of a classic blackjack table that caps the betting range at $5‑$500. The low‑end limit forces novices to make 20 hands per hour to reach a $100 target, a pace that inflates the house edge by approximately 0.2% due to increased exposure.
